    Wow. Just Wow. I like many others have driven past this location curious as to what was going in & then curious as to what "PDQ" really was. Is it like Zaxby's? Maybe a new twist on Chick-fil-a? Is it like Publix Deli Chicken? Well the answer to all of those questions is a resounding NO! PDQ is unlike any quick service restaurant I've ever had the pleasure of visiting. I had the pleasure of taking their "Fresh Tour" with General Manager Jeremy & Catering Director Dale. After explaining a bit about the background of the brand (The founder of Outback is involved) and a bit more about their philosophy (PDQ stands for People Dedicated to Quality), they took us on a tour of their entire back of the house. Their dedication to Quality and Fresh Food Fast standard was reflected in everything that they do. From cutting fries fresh to not having a freezer in the restaurant (how many fast food joints can boast that), their core values are present and well exercised. Coming from a background in restaurant management myself, it's easy for me to find fault from either and ingredient or operations point of view, and while Jeremy was very up front that they are "still learning", I couldn't find anything wrong with what they were doing, or how they were setup. The restaurant flows well, the stations in the 'heart of the house' as they call it are well thought out and their staff is top notch. After our tour we were able to get down to what counts most, while a good clean kitchen and great company vision are important, the food is what's going to make or break an establishment, and let me tell you PDQ knocks that out of the park! Their Tenders are amazing, the house made sauces are perfection. The apple slices with toffee dipping sauce were a delightful surprise at a "fried chicken joint", as were their hand spun milkshakes.
